Lord
Licked by Jan Itor
|
Hi! Ich studiere Informatik am Technikum Wien und als Projekt für das nächste Semester möchte ich ein 3d-Spiel programmieren (natürlich nicht alleine *g*) Story steht zumindest in den Grundzügen fest, das ganze wird in Richtung Rollenspiel. Ich bin schon seit ca. 1 Monat auf der Suche nach der besten Opensource-3d-Engine für das Projekt, das sind bis jetzt die Ergebnisse: - Ogre3D (http://www.ogre3d.org/)
Bis jetzt meine Wahl Nr. 1: Gute Grafik, solide, genug Erweiterungen für Physik, Steuerung, Sound, etc... und eine angeblich sehr gute Community. (Was ich bis jetzt in div. Foren gelesen hab dürfts auch stimmen) - Nebula 2 (http://www.radonlabs.de/)
Die Grafik dieser Engine ist der Wahnsinn, ich weiß allerdings nicht wies mit Community, Erweiterungen, etc. ausschaut Kleines Beispielvideo eines genialen Skybox-Systems: http://www.alienstealth.de/mig/skys.../video_dusk.avi - Irrlicht (http://irrlicht.sourceforge.net/)
Scheint ähnlich zu sein wie Ogre3D, nur nicht ganz so gut... ka - Ut2k4-Engine
Das wäre in meinen Augen keine schlechte Alternative, würde dann halt eine Total Conversion für Ut2k4 werden. Positv dabei wäre die Skriptlanguage, Lvl-Editor, Tonnen an predesigned Meshes/Textures/Sounds und ein gigantische Community. Nachteil: jeder braucht Ut2k4 und Erfahrungen damit...
Das wären einmal die Engines die ich bis jetzt so gefunden hab, jetzt seid ihr gefragt! Mich würden a) Meinungen/Erfahrungen von euch zu den von mir aufgelisteten Engines interessieren und/oder b) auch andere Opensource Engines als Alternativen interessieren! TiA Lo_Ord P.S.: sollte der Thread hier fehl am Platze sein -> Plz move!
|
BlueAngel
Silencer
|
quake 3 engine! soll ja demnächst opensource werden!
|
ill
...
|
Tja, ich habe mal eine zeit lang Ogre3D verwendet und es hat mir eigentlich recht gut gefallen, wenn man sich mal eingearbeitet hat, kann man ganz passable sachen damit machen, von Irrlicht hab ich auch schon so einiges gehört, jedoch nie selbst verwendet...
Ich persönlich würde glaube ich doch zur UT Engine greifen, da, wie du eben schon gesagt hast, die ganze "Entwicklungsumgebung" und ein Haufen vorgefertige (oft sehr gute) Materialien zur Verfügung stehen...
|
Lord
Licked by Jan Itor
|
Das mit Ut ist allerdings erstmal als Alternative gedacht weil ich nicht weiß was die Lektoren davon halten, das das Spiel nicht standalone sein wird...
|
issue
Rock and Stone, brother!
|
hab mit den anderen engines keine erfahrungen, aber ut2k4 engine is net schwer zum coden. ich hab für ut2k4 schon diverse kleinere mods geschrieben, alles nur nach den video tuts die dabei waren bei der dvd SE. das groesste war ein trickjump mod, den source hab ich dann aber den dpm entwicklern gegeben und die haben einen imho sehr guten mod drausgemacht
|
FragCool
OC Addicted
|
Hängt ganz davon ab wie weit du rein must D.h. ob so ein Devkit wie für UT und Q3 ausreicht oder ob du ganz rein mußt Es gibt dann noch Q2 und Doom wenns einfacher sein soll. Oder Crystal Space... die ist schon ewig in Entwicklung und kann unglaublich viel, der Source ist aber wohl auch dementsprechend umfangreich... http://sourceforge.net/projects/crystal/
|
sk/\r
i never asked for this
|
@FragCool: die übrigens auch für die inoffizielle outcast fortsetzung benutzt wird. siehe auch: Open Outcast
|
Bowser
Addicted
|
Wieso eigentlich nicht einfach einen Mod für HL2 machen? Da hast gleich die neuesten Grafiken und Physik. Von den Möglichkeiten bist sicher auch nicht eingeschränkt, weil Source ja wieder speziell für Mods gemacht wurde.
|
Lord
Licked by Jan Itor
|
Hmm, stimmt, die gibts ja auch noch. Wenn da nicht Steam wäre @Fragcool: Wie tief ich reinmuss weiß ich noch nicht, bin noch in der Entwurfsphase... Und Crystalspace schaut nett aus, dürft aber wie du gesagt hast so Umfangreich wie Nebula2 sein... MfG Lo_Ord
|
Bowser
Addicted
|
Was für ein Problem hast du mit Steam? Ich hab bis jetzt noch keine schlechten Erfahrungen damit gemacht.
|
Lord
Licked by Jan Itor
|
Ich kanns einfach nicht ausstehen, vor allem wenn Spiele wie Hl 1 (!) 10 Minuten brauchen bis sie starten nur weil Steam wieder mal updaten muss... Ohne jetzt eine Diskussion über Sinn und Unsinn loszetteln zu wollen, aber mir ist es einfach nicht sympatisch.
Allerdings ist die Hl2-Engine eine Alternative, muss ich zugeben
|
Bowser
Addicted
|
Ok, deine Meinung, da will ich eh nix mehr sagen. Übrigens is die SDK für Source ziemlich nett. Ich hab mich da kurz eingelesen und es dürft relativ einfach sein da MODs zu basteln. Syntax is im C++ Style und eigentlich sollt ich mich da genauer einlesen... wenn ich nur Zeit hätt. http://developer.valvesoftware.com/wiki/SDK_Docs
|
that
Hoffnungsloser Optimist
|
Ich würde sicher nicht mein Softwareprodukt davon abhängig machen, dass ein anderer Hersteller seine Aktivierungsserver weiter betreibt.
Wenn Valve irgendwann der Meinung ist, die Welt hätte genug HL2 gespielt (oder pleite geht oder aufgekauft wird oder was auch immer), dann sind plötzlich alle gekauften Spiele für immer unbrauchbar. Nein danke, ohne mich.
|
Bowser
Addicted
|
Eher unwarscheinlich. Is is warscheinlicher, dass es einen letzten Patch gibt, der das ganze unabhängig von den Content Servern macht. Außerdem: Funkt Steam derzeit nicht im Offline Mode??!!
|
ica
hmm
|
|